What companies run services between Melbourne, VIC, Australia and Carlsruhe, VIC, Australia?

V-Line Buses operates a bus from Southern Cross Coach Terminal/Spencer St to Kyneton Station/Kyneton-Trentham Rd once daily. Tickets cost $1–16 and the journey takes 1h 7m. Alternatively, V/Line operates a train from Southern Cross Station to Kyneton Station hourly. Tickets cost $8–12 and the journey takes 1h 10m.
